The Manager, Master Data Management (MDM) is responsible for defining, implementing, and governing the enterprise data framework across Pulse Vehicles. The role ensures data consistency, quality, and standardization to enable seamless integration with JBPCO standard systems (e.g., ERP, finance, engineering, supply chain platforms). This leader will establish data governance, ownership, and stewardship models while driving alignment across business units and IT teams.
Summaryof Activities
- MDM Strategy & Governance
- Define and implement the MDM strategy aligned to JBPCO standards
- Establish data governance framework (policies, roles, stewardship)
- Define data domains ownership (customer, vendor, product, assets, etc.)
- Lead creation of data standards, naming conventions, and taxonomies
- Data Integration & Transformation
- Enable data harmonization across multiple legacy systems
- Support ERP and enterprise platforms integration (e.g., JDE migration)
- Ensure consistent master data structure across all systems
- Data Quality & Lifecycle Management
- Define KPIs and controls for data quality (accuracy, completeness, timeliness)
- Implement data cleansing, enrichment, and validation processes
- Deploy monitoring dashboards and governance workflows
- Stakeholder Engagement
- Act as bridge between IT and business units
- Lead cross‑functional workshops across Pulse sites
- Align stakeholders on common data definitions and governance rules
- Tools & Architecture
- Evaluate and implement MDM tools/platforms
- Ensure alignment with enterprise architecture and cybersecurity policies
- Work closely with security and compliance teams (aligned with JBPCO policies on governance, access, and auditability)
- Change Management
- Drive cultural transformation toward data ownership and accountability
- Develop training materials and governance adoption plans
